Before demystifying computer vision in retail, we need to answer this question: What is computer vision? Think of it as a technology that enables machines to interpret and understand visual information from the world, much like humans do. This subfield of artificial intelligence (AI) leverages advanced algorithms like deep learning and neural networks to convert raw visual data into meaningful insights that machines can act upon.
Computer vision is already used across many industries, but few are as profoundly impacted by it as the retail sector. Retailers are using AI-powered image and video analysis to automate and optimize in-store operations, enhance customer experience, and drive data-driven decision-making, creating smarter, safer, and more efficient store environments.

Cashierless stores
Customers today crave convenience, and waiting in long queues for manual scanning at a checkout counter may be the last thing they want. Computer vision offers a much-loved checkout experience through cashierless store models that eliminate the need for traditional point-of-sale systems.
By combining AI-powered cameras, sensors, and deep learning algorithms, these systems can identify products as customers pick them up, track their movements in real time, and automatically process payments when they exit the store. This not only removes friction but also enhances accuracy, prevents theft, and offers detailed insights into consumer behavior.

Automated inventory management
Keeping store shelves not just fully, but accurately stocked has long been a pain point in retail. Thankfully, with real-time shelf monitoring - one of the most impactful applications of computer vision in retail - inventory management is finally catching up to the speed of modern shopping.
Smart cameras and shelf-scanning robots now monitor product availability in real time, flagging empty spots, misplaced items, and even pricing errors before customers notice. Going beyond just automating inventory checks, these AI-powered systems help prevent lost sales by triggering instant restock alerts and, in some cases, initiating auto-replenishment. Retailers can also gain access to data-rich insights that power demand forecasting, reduce overstock and waste, and keep operations agile.
Retail heat maps
Ever wondered which parts of your store truly capture attention? Retail heat maps are an innovative computer vision application in retail that can help you with this, providing insights into how customers move, pause, and interact throughout your store.
Computer vision systems generate visuals that highlight traffic density in real time, allowing you to identify hot zones, overlooked areas, and behavioral trends. This insight is invaluable as it helps you reposition products, adjust store layouts, and tailor promotional displays for better visibility. The result? A more intuitive shopping experience, smarter staffing decisions, and improved conversion rates across the board.

Loss prevention
Theft and fraud are silent profit killers that retailers constantly battle, but computer vision is making them less of a headache. With object detection, tracking, and behavioral analysis working in sync, computer vision systems help you proactively navigate threats.
These systems scan live video feeds to spot high-risk items, follow their movement through the store, and raise flags when behavior veers off script, like bypassing the checkout. But this tech isn’t just about watching - it’s about understanding. Computer vision interprets body language, unusual movements, and repeated behaviors (like lingering near high-value goods) to predict intent and prevent theft rather than react to outcomes.
Facial recognition, image recognition, and pose estimation are other critical computer vision AI-based loss prevention measures. They provide an extra layer of security, helping you detect known shoplifters or catch someone slipping items into a bag. Even self-checkout lanes aren’t off the grid anymore, as the system can instantly flag unscanned items or suspicious hand movements. The best part? AI learns from every incident, so it keeps getting smarter and more reliable over time.

Virtual mirrors
As customers increasingly seek enjoyable shopping experiences, traditional fitting rooms are stepping aside for virtual mirrors. These mirrors are one of the most exciting applications of computer vision in retail, combining AR (augmented reality) and computer vision to turn a simple reflection into an immersive, interactive shopping moment. Behind the glass, smart cameras and displays work together to simulate how clothes, accessories, or makeup would look in real life with no changing required.
Whether it's finding the perfect lipstick shade or styling an outfit from head to toe, virtual mirrors provide real-time feedback and personalized recommendations like a built-in stylist. Smart fitting rooms can even detect the items a customer brings in, offering other sizes, colors, or matching pieces at the tap of a screen. By upgrading the in-store experience, this technology boosts buyer confidence and satisfaction, which can reduce returns and improve sales for your business.

Visual search
Visual search is redefining how recommendation engines work, helping customers discover products just by taking or uploading a photo of what they are looking for. Whether it's a customer taking a snap of a stylish lamp in-store or using an app to find a similar dress they saw online, visual search bridges the gap between inspiration and purchase.
In-store kiosks and mobile tools powered by computer vision help shoppers locate similar items, compare prices, or explore complementary products in seconds. It’s especially powerful in visually driven categories like fashion, home décor, and electronics. Beyond convenience, this tech gives retailers valuable insights into what catches a shopper’s eye, even if they don’t buy right away.

Retail foot traffic monitoring
Foot traffic tells the story of your store - from where customers walk to where they stop and what they skip. With AI-powered computer vision, retailers can go from simple people-counting to advanced footfall analysis, including pass-by traffic and interactions. This technology tracks customer flow, pinpoints high-traffic areas, and identifies zones that need more attention.
If you want to know which promotions pull people in or which aisles go unnoticed, computer vision gives you the answers in real-time. It can even work with your existing cameras to generate insights that help optimize store layouts, staffing schedules, and marketing strategies.

Crowd analysis
Among the many applications of computer vision in retail, crowd analysis is transforming the way stores operate. By monitoring crowd density in real-time, you can prevent overcrowding, especially during peak hours or major sales events. AI-driven systems can also detect congestion, predict line lengths, and optimize resource allocation.
For example, when the system “sees” that lines are getting too long - potentially driving customers away - it may alert staff to open new checkout counters or adjust floor personnel, ensuring smoother traffic flow and shorter wait times. This proactive crowd control has become a crucial strategy for delivering hassle-free, high-retention shopping experiences.
Stocking and planograms
Computer vision is transforming shelf management through intelligent stocking and planogram compliance. AI-powered systems continuously monitor smart shelves to detect out-of-stock items, misplaced products, or layout discrepancies, and then trigger real-time alerts for quick restocking or display corrections. This not only prevents missed sales opportunities but also ensures products are always correctly positioned to maximize visibility and meet supplier standards. Ultimately, this tech-driven precision leads to better-organized stores, streamlined operations, and a more seamless shopping experience.

While the applications of computer vision in retail are enormous, adopting this technology isn't without its challenges. From cost barriers to privacy concerns, retailers need to carefully plan their approach to make implementation successful and sustainable.
High implementation costs
Getting started with computer vision can be expensive. It often requires specialized cameras, edge computing hardware, and AI software - along with integration into existing systems. For small and mid-sized businesses, these upfront and ongoing costs can be a major hurdle.
Privacy and data compliance
Since computer vision relies on collecting visual data, it naturally raises questions about customer privacy. Retailers must comply with strict regulations like the GDPR and CCPA, which govern how personal data is collected and used. To avoid losing customer trust, transparency and secure data practices are a must.
Accuracy and bias issues
AI models can sometimes misidentify products or people, especially in stores with poor lighting, crowded shelves, or unusual camera angles. These errors can affect checkout accuracy or even lead to uncomfortable customer experiences. In addition, if the training data used to develop the system isn’t diverse, the AI may produce biased or inconsistent results.

Integration difficulties
Many retailers still rely on older point-of-sale (POS) or inventory systems that aren’t designed to work with modern AI technologies. Connecting these systems with computer vision tools can be time-consuming and expensive without the right technical support or middleware solutions.
Real-time performance demands
For applications like automated checkouts or live inventory tracking, speed matters. If the system processes data too slowly, it can lead to delays and poor customer service. Efficient processing requires powerful hardware and finely-tuned AI models to deliver real-time results.

Faster decisions with edge computing
Instead of sending data to distant servers, edge computing allows retailers to process visual information right where it’s captured - in the store. This means faster response times for things like inventory tracking, shopper behavior analysis, and real-time pricing adjustments, leading to smoother, more responsive operations.
